My issue is the misdirection discussing lazy filelist downloading as a
"solution" to the "problem" of huge amounts of data that is forced to
be downloaded and loaded.

The issue has been discussed repeatedly without a solution.

Adding -- and maintaining -- patterns or whitelist exceptions, which
moves file dependencies into primary.xml is actually an approach that
solves the problem, and scales to multiple repos as well, each of
which also will have their own patterns and whitelist.

Actually, you do not need to maintain whitelists manually, just having createrepo automatically whitelist all the file deps it finds referenced in the indexed repo would solve most of the problem.

If you want to be fancy, you could also add an option to pass it the url of another repo is should inherit whitelists from (for updates, epel, etc)

Manual whitelists will go stale fast
